Output 2359de63f4790c36006f34ae0585caef5f19933d8d40ce795398a5abc2832e41:3

value
21250356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c705d49ba5c1c822fd38db16c1b44e33a25237f OP_EQUAL
address
MDQjP9zTnRBKS6NamLxiDLakf259JGQuU9
transaction
2359de63f4790c36006f34ae0585caef5f19933d8d40ce795398a5abc2832e41
spent
true